Logo ms.removalsclassifieds.com

Perbezaan Antara AHCI dan IDE (Dengan Jadual)

Isi kandungan:

Anonim

Komputer adalah bahagian paling penting dalam dunia yang sedang berkembang hari ini. Mereka telah menjadi penyelesaian utama untuk menjadikan sebarang masalah lebih mudah. Daripada komputer yang pertama, paling asas hingga yang paling canggih hari ini, terdapat banyak komponen yang digunakan untuk menjadikannya lebih pantas dan lebih cekap. Sebahagian daripada mereka ialah AHCI dan IDE.

AHCI lwn IDE

Perbezaan antara AHCI vs IDE ialah IDE ialah persekitaran yang lebih lama manakala AHCI ialah versi antara muka yang lebih baharu dan ia membolehkan ciri yang lebih maju daripada IDE. AHCI menyokong pengubahsuaian peranti yang lebih baharu bagi SATA manakala IDE tidak serasi dengannya.

AHCI atau Antara Muka Pengawal Hos Lanjutan ialah antara muka yang membantu Lampiran Teknologi Lanjutan Bersiri atau SATA untuk berkomunikasi dengan perisian. Ia ialah peranti kelas PCI yang membantu pertukaran data antara media storan SATA dan ruang memori sistem. Ia pertama kali ditakrifkan pada tahun 2004 oleh Intel.

IDE atau Persekitaran Pembangunan Bersepadu ialah aplikasi yang membantu pengaturcara menyepadukan bahagian berlainan program komputer. Ia adalah aplikasi yang dicipta untuk menggabungkan pelbagai aspek pengaturcaraan seperti mengedit kod, nyahpepijat dan membina boleh laku ke dalam satu aplikasi tunggal. Bahasa pertama yang membolehkan penciptaan IDE ialah Dartmouth BASIC.

Jadual Perbandingan Antara AHCI dan IDE

Parameter Perbandingan

AHCI

IDE

Definisi AHCI ialah peranti standard teknikal yang membantu pertukaran data antara media storan SATA dan ruang memori sistem. IDE ialah piawaian antara muka yang membantu pengaturcara menyepadukan bahagian berlainan program komputer.
wayar Wayar AHCI tidak begitu berat. Wayarnya lebih besar dan sangat mahal.
Kelajuan Ia lebih cepat dalam kerjanya. Ia lebih perlahan dalam kerjanya.
Sokongan ciri baharu Ia menyokong ciri baharu seperti pertukaran panas dan NCQ. Ia tidak menyokong ciri baharu kerana ia adalah versi yang lebih lama.
Disokong oleh OS mana Ia disokong oleh Windows, Linux, Solaris 10, OpenBSD. Ia disokong oleh versi sistem pengendalian yang lebih lama.

Apakah AHCI?

Antara Muka Pengawal Hos Lanjutan atau AHCI ialah standard teknikal yang membolehkan pertukaran data dan arahan antara SATA dan sistem. Ia pertama kali ditakrifkan oleh Intel pada tahun 2004. Syarikat lain yang memilih yang sama ialah Dell, Microsoft, AMD, Marvell, Maxtor, Red Hat, Seagate dan Storage Gear.

Ia adalah mod operasi yang diaktifkan sebelum sistem pengendalian dipasang. Dalam sistem tertentu, sukar untuk beralih ke sistem AHCI selepas memasang OS tetapi dalam sistem Windows, seseorang boleh bertukar kepada AHCI walaupun selepas memasang OS. AHCI mempunyai satu baris gilir storan dan mempunyai kedalaman baris gilir sebanyak 32 arahan. Ini pada asasnya bermakna bahawa 32 permintaan input-output boleh terus menunggu dalam baris gilir sekaligus dalam AHCI.

AHCI ialah peranti yang termasuk dalam kelas peranti Saling Sambung Komponen Periferi atau PCI. Pengaktifan AHCI membolehkan seseorang mengakses semua jenis ciri lanjutan SATA seperti Native Command Queuing atau NCQ dan hot-swapping. AHCI mengalami kelewatan yang lebih lama apabila digunakan dengan SSD dan permintaan I/O mereka sering mengalami kesesakan disebabkan kedalaman baris gilir yang terhad. AHCI memberi bantuan pembangun dalam pengaturcaraan, pengesanan dan konfigurasi penyesuai SATA/AHCI.

Apakah IDE?

IDE atau Persekitaran Pembangunan Bersepadu ialah aplikasi perisian yang membantu pengaturcara membangunkan bahagian aplikasi mereka yang berbeza dengan membantu dalam penyuntingan kod sumber, membina boleh laku dan nyahpepijat. Mereka memaksimumkan produktiviti pengaturcara dengan menyusun segala-galanya ke dalam satu aplikasi.

Ia adalah mungkin untuk membina aplikasi tanpa IDE atau mencipta IDE sendiri, tetapi pendekatan ini sangat memakan masa dan boleh dilaksanakan hanya apabila keperluan jika pembangun memerlukan penyesuaian tidak tersedia dalam IDE asal. IDE memudahkan pembangun dalam mengatur aliran kerja mereka dan menyelesaikan masalah dengan lebih cepat. Sesetengah ciri seperti penyiapan kod automatik atau kod yang dijana secara automatik membantu dalam mengurangkan masa yang diperlukan untuk menaip keseluruhan rentetan kod.

IDE dipilih berdasarkan bilangan bahasa yang disokongnya, sistem pengendalian yang disokongnya, pemalamnya, sambungannya dan kesannya terhadap prestasi sistem. Penyahpepijatan ialah salah satu ciri terpenting IDE untuk menjalankan program dengan lancar dan berjaya. Beberapa contoh IDE ialah Visual Studios, NetBeans dan Eclipse.

Terdapat terutamanya dua jenis IDE; Mudah Alih dan Awan. Walaupun IDE mengurangkan masa, pembelajaran pada peringkat awal memerlukan sedikit masa dan kesabaran. Oleh itu, untuk memaksimumkan faedah seseorang mesti mengorbankan sedikit masa untuk mempelajari cara persekitaran berfungsi. Ia juga dianggap bukan alat terbaik untuk pengaturcara peringkat pemula.

Perbezaan Utama Antara AHCI dan IDE

Perbezaan utama antara AHCI dan IDE ialah AHCI lebih baharu daripada IDE dan AHCI ialah standard teknikal yang memudahkan pertukaran data antara storan SATA dan sistem manakala IDE membolehkan komunikasi antara peranti storan yang berbeza seperti cakera keras dan sistem dan merupakan aplikasi yang membantu pembangun memaksimumkan produktiviti mereka. Perbezaan lain adalah seperti berikut:

Kesimpulan

Komputer terus berkembang dan memerlukan teknologi terkini untuk naik tarafnya. Antara AHCI dan IDE, AHCI telah ditunjukkan untuk menunjukkan ciri yang lebih baik dan keserasian dengan semua OS terkini dan menunjukkan kecekapan yang lebih. Oleh itu, pilihan antara muka bergantung sepenuhnya pada sistem yang ia serasi dan untuk tujuan apa ia diperlukan.

IDE lebih disukai oleh pengaturcara untuk membina aplikasi mereka kerana ia mudah digunakan setelah mereka memahaminya. Walaupun pengaturcara boleh mencipta IDE mereka sendiri untuk tujuan penyesuaian tambahan, kebanyakannya lebih suka IDE tradisional.

Rujukan

Perbezaan Antara AHCI dan IDE (Dengan Jadual)